Description


On this episode of Young and Oldish Money, we talk about ideas on how to spend your tax refund.  Then we’ll discuss Apple’s recent addition to the Dow Jones Industrial Average index.  What does it mean and is it a big deal?  And we end with some advice on making sure you’re setting realistic expectations when you invest.
